To the Board:

Negotiations with the landlord of our Thornbury distribution depot have reached a decision point. The proposed renewal carries a 12% uplift over seven years, against market comparables suggesting 7–8%. We have countered with a five-year term, a capped escalator, and a fit-out contribution. Walking away remains viable: the Gellam Park site offers comparable capacity at lower cost but would disrupt operations for roughly ten weeks. Our recommendation depends on the confidential considerations set out below.

board note of bawep-tajef: Queniusek Systems plans to raise the Quenvan list price by 53.1 percent in March. The pricing group signed off on a budget of $176.4 million for Project Drueth. The renewal with Casionix Partners closes at $142.5 million a year, 8.3 percent below the last contract. Project Fraax slips by six weeks because of the tooling delay.

Subject: On-call handover — orders soft deletes

Hi Marek,

Quick note before you take over. We shipped the soft-delete change to the Cartwheel orders table last night: rows now get a deleted_at timestamp instead of being removed. Plugin authors querying orders directly must filter on deleted_at IS NULL, or they'll see ghost orders. The compat view orders_active handles this automatically. Docs are updated in the Cartwheel developer portal. If plugin authors hit anything weird, route them to the integrations inbox.

escalation mailbox, tafop-fahif: oliael@tolvaqlabs.corp

Subject: Rate limiting on the Quillgate API gateway

Hi, and welcome to the on-call rotation. Quillgate enforces per-service token buckets, and breaches surface as 429 spikes in the gateway dashboard. Before raising any limits, confirm the calling service isn't retrying without backoff — that's the cause nine times out of ten. We'll review open limit-change requests at the weekly eng sync. The full policy and override process live here:

dashboard of bajog-fahif = https://confluence.zemvarlabs.internal/display/display/display/2c2702ee